Group calendar

The Group calendar web part allows you to easily view the calendar of an existing modern group on a page. Just select the group you’d like to link, select the number of calendar events per page you’d like to show, and the web part will automatically populate the events.

 

 Screen Shot 2017-08-22 at 8.15.01 PM.png    Screen Shot 2017-08-22 at 8.20.00 PM.png

 

Easily switch between past and upcoming events, get more details about a specific event, and even download the event to add to your calendar.

It defaults groups to a different timezone (usually UTC) for every group we make.

  • Go to the group site page
  • Click the top right settings button (the little gear)
  • Site information
  • View all site settings
  • Regional Settings
    • Right column under Site Administration
    • Time Zone should be the first option in there
